summ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orJason Ekstrand <jason.ekstrand@intel.com>2016-12-05 22:09:35 -0800
committerEmil Velikov <emil.l.velikov@gmail.com>2016-12-14 19:03:11 +0000
commit983c38af2a45bb1192a4d30d26b44447fc532606 (patch)
tree333c84788d0b9100906001261f693a04e682bf29
parent41c18889be9844213b989705781f56865b82117d (diff)
downloadexternal_mesa3d-983c38af2a45bb1192a4d30d26b44447fc532606.zip
external_mesa3d-983c38af2a45bb1192a4d30d26b44447fc532606.tar.gz
external_mesa3d-983c38af2a45bb1192a4d30d26b44447fc532606.tar.bz2
genxml/gen9: Change the default of MI_SEMAPHORE_WAIT::RegisterPoleMode
We would really like it to be false as that's what you get on hardware that doesn't have RegisterPoleMode (Sky Lake for example). While we're at it, we change it to a boolean. This fixes dEQP-VK.synchronization.smoke.events on Broxton. Reviewed-by: Kenneth Graunke <kenneth@whitecape.org> Cc: "13.0" <mesa-stable@lists.freedesktop.org> (cherry picked from commit eb7b51d62ae541ff351b4335c6d2f2e1a3a8bbce)
-rw-r--r--src/intel/genxml/gen9.xml2
1 files changed, 1 insertions, 1 deletions
diff --git a/src/intel/genxml/gen9.xml b/src/intel/genxml/gen9.xml
index 0dfce3f..5d2bc96 100644
--- a/src/intel/genxml/gen9.xml
+++ b/src/intel/genxml/gen9.xml
@@ -3194,7 +3194,7 @@
<value name="Per Process Graphics Address" value="0"/>
<value name="Global Graphics Address" value="1"/>
</field>
- <field name="Register Poll Mode" start="16" end="16" type="uint" default="1"/>
+ <field name="Register Poll Mode" start="16" end="16" type="bool"/>
<field name="Wait Mode" start="15" end="15" type="uint">
<value name="Polling Mode" value="1"/>
<value name="Signal Mode" value="0"/>